English: Illumination of Earth by the Sun on the day of the summer solstice in the northern hemisphere.
A view of the eastern hemisphere showing noon in Central European time zone (ignoring DST) on the day of the summer solstice (in the northern hemisphere — this is the winter solstice in the southern hemisphere).
